What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To get the idea the relevance of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to first break down what a freestyle beat actually is. In simple terms, a freestyle beat is an important track that is developed for artists to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's indicated to inspire off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rappers to provide spontaneous and commonly much more raw, psychological verses.

A freestyle type beat varies slightly from a normal instrumental in that it's structured in such a way that gives musicians area to breathe. These beats often have fewer ariose elements, leaving area for detailed flows and effective wordplay. They're at the same time normally more repeated than typical song instrumentals, making sure that the rap artist or singer can easily discover their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in complex pl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a particular part refer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, stemming from the southerly USA, is identified by big use 808 bass drums, quickly h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a audio that has actually expanded in appeal for many years, turning into one of one of the most significant styles in modern-day r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ark factors and fuse them with the flexibility and versatility of freestyle beats, resulting in a valuable combo. These beats are ideal for musicians aiming to bring power and hostility to their verses while still keeping the flexibility to explore various flows and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Star

Among the many variants of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ually become one of one of the most in-demand. DaBaby type beats are influenced by the trademark noise of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, understood for his rapid-fire shipment, catchy hooks, and compelling manufacturing. These beats commonly feature rapid tempos,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ile tunes, making them ideal for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So perfect for Freestyles

1. Quick Paces: The quick pace of a DaBaby type beat motivates rap artists to provide speedy flows, forcing them to believe on their feet and press their lyrical boundaries.
2. Basic Yet Memorable Melodies: Unlike some trap beats that can be overly complicated, DaBaby type beats are often built around basic, recurring melodies that leave space for the rap artist's vocals to shine.
3. Powerful Drums: The hostile percussion in these beats adds an element of seriousness, driving the musician to match the beat's strength with their verses.

Whether you're a follower of DaBaby's music or not, there's no rejecting the influence his noise has actually carried modern-day freestyle society.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at globe, providing rap artists a system to display their rate, accuracy, and personal appeal.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ers give free of charge use, typically for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be utilized for demos, freestyles, and social media sites web content, artists generally require to pay for a license if they intend to release the track comm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or offer for sale).

This design has actually been a game-changer, enabling young musicians to explore their sound, exercise their freestyling, and develop an internet-based existence without needing to stress over manufacturing costs.
